The Cause:   While in recent years, this was considered a terminal condition with a short survival rate, there have been advances that can prolong life and improve quality of life for these patients.  However, this involves an invasive procedure that is only available at certain major medical institutions.  This required her to travel to seek the opinions of four specialists traveling to Wake Forest-North Carolina, UPMC-Pittsburgh, and Mercy Medical and UMMC- both in Baltimore.  Since her cancer is aggressive, they recommended she start chemotherapy first to try to reduce the disease burden.  They were concerned she had too much disease to even perform the procedure.  She decided to move forward with the surgical oncologist in Pittsburgh. It is closest to home and yet, still an 8 hour drive from where she lives in Evansville, IN.  She had to travel back there to have a minor procedure done in order to determine if she was a candidate for the major surgery.  She was given the green light on that and it is scheduled for 7/24.  They call this the MOAS (Mother of All Surgeries) as it is an incredibly invasive surgery with a painfully long recovery.
